WebAffidavit Separation By Employer Sample Pdf If you ally dependence such a referred Affidavit Separation By Employer Sample Pdf ebook that will give you worth, get the very best seller from us currently from several preferred authors. ... is evidence that you are employed a proof to show that you are capable of paying rentals mortgages or WebThat portion of the Employer's Report of Separation and Wage Information to be completed by the employing unit shall set forth: 1. The date the worker began working; 2. The last day on which he actually worked; 3. The reason for separation; 4. Such other information as is required by such form.
